Book Description

December 23, 2003

Mexico is a country steeped in history with a rich cultural heritage, varied landscape, and vibrant fusion of styles evident in the architecture, interiors, and design to be found across the country. Photographer Mark Luscombe-Whyte and writer Dominic Bradbury have traveled Mexico from coast to coast seeking out exquisite examples of Mexican architecture and design. From simple rural adobe dwelling and ornately decorated churches to deluxe seaside retreats and high-tech modern structures, they explore the evolution of Mexican style from the traditional dwellings of ancient civilizations to cutting-edge projects from today's most influential designers.

A combination of seductive photographs and incisive text, Mexico is an essential sourcebook of ideas and inspiration for anyone with a passion for Mexican culture.

About the Author

Dominic Bradbury is a noted expert in the fields of architecture and interior design whose writings have appeared in publications such as "House & Garden", "Homes & Gardens", "Elle Decoration", and others. He is also the author of several books on the subject including Mexico: Architecture • Interiors • Design.

5.0 out of 5 stars The Grand Tour, December 23, 2003
By 
This review is from: Mexico: Architecture - Interiors - Design (Hardcover)
Outstanding in its ability to capture the range of Mexican architecture and design from the historic haciendas to the stunning modernist houses of Mexico City.
The best part, however, are the amazing sensual houses of Careyes and Cuixmala, you can practically feel the sea breezes.
